SIOUX FALLS, SD (KELO.com) — Two area men face lengthy federal prison sentences as the U-S Attorneys Office racks up more convictions against members of a major drug ring. 50-year old Cary Ludens of Crooks was sentenced to 13 years and 3 months. Officials say he distributed about 22 pounds of meth that came from Arizona and was sold in the Sioux Falls area. 31 Year old Robert Kent was also sentenced to seven and a half years in prison. He distributed about a pound of meth in the area for the same drug ring.
